Synopsis
When John is six years old, in 1932, he discovers an old stone pipe laying in the mud of a hog wallow on his family's farm in the Coal Creek Valley, near present day Montrose, Colorado. At age eleven John is critically ill after a ruptured appendix. John hovers between life and death. The spirit of Chief Ouray, a Ute leader, keeps vigil over John, telling him he is Keeper of the Pipe. Readers will follow John's life long journey to protect the pipe and to eventually return it to the Ute people.
